Creating a personal learning journal using Pages

Pages is a fantastic tool for creating digital learning journals/scaffolds that can be easily shared with students.

A digital learning journal can not only provide a great scaffold for learning, it can also give our students the opportunity to receive information and express themselves in different ways - using text, audio, drawing, photo and video.

The example I used in the demonstration was a personal learning journal that invites students to reflect on their learning and wellbeing. It shows examples of how students might interact with a digital journal and can very easily be modified and personalised, depending on the students you are working with.
